C++ 定义对象的时候调用构造函数问题。
在构造函数不止一个的情况下,定义对象的时候,是只调用默认构造函数,还是其他的构造函数也会被调用呢? 求教。class A
{
public:
A();
A(int x=5);
...
private:
int x;
}
....
int main()
{
A *obj = new A[10];
...
}
2013-12-22 21:47
2013-12-22 22:02
谢谢 懂了 只会调用符合参数的那一个
2013-12-22 22:55
2013-12-23 15:36